Part Overview
The ECJ-2VB2D332K is a 3300 pF ceramic capacitor rated at 200V with X7R temperature coefficient in 0805 (2012 Metric) surface mount package, manufactured by Panasonic Electronic Components. This part is classified as obsolete, making equivalent and substitute parts necessary for ongoing design support and procurement.
The capacitor is designed for general purpose applications requiring stable capacitance across the operating temperature range of -55°C to 125°C. Direct substitutes maintain identical electrical specifications, while upgrade options provide enhanced voltage ratings, improved tolerance, or alternative temperature coefficients for applications requiring higher performance margins.

Substitute Part Grouping Explanation
Substitution for ECJ-2VB2D332K is determined by strict equivalence in the following parameters:
- Capacitance: 3300 pF (exact match required)
- Voltage Rating: 200V minimum (equal or higher acceptable)
- Temperature Coefficient: X7R (maintains capacitance stability across operating range)
- Package: 0805 (2012 Metric) surface mount
- Tolerance: ±10% or tighter (±5% acceptable as upgrade)
- Operating Temperature: -55°C to 125°C (minimum requirement)
- Mounting: Surface Mount, MLCC
Direct substitutes maintain all specifications at 200V with ±10% tolerance. Upgrade options provide higher voltage ratings (250V, 500V, 630V), improved tolerance (±5%), or alternative temperature coefficients (C0G/NP0) while preserving the 3300 pF capacitance and 0805 package form factor.

Engineering Selection Recommendations
Direct Substitutes (200V, ±10%, X7R): C0805C332K2RAC7800 (KEMET), CC0805KRX7RABB332 (YAGEO), and KGM21AR72D332KU (KYOCERA AVX) provide electrical equivalence to ECJ-2VB2D332K. All three are active products with ROHS3 compliance. KEMET C0805C332K2RAC7800 offers the smallest thickness profile (0.88mm) for space-constrained layouts. YAGEO and KYOCERA AVX options provide higher inventory availability.
Tolerance Upgrade (200V, ±5%, X7R): C0805C332J2RAC7800 (KEMET) maintains 200V rating with improved ±5% tolerance, suitable for applications requiring tighter capacitance control without voltage derating.
Voltage Upgrades (250V, X7R): C0805C332KARAC7800 (KEMET) provides 250V rating with ±10% tolerance. C0805C332JARAC7800 (KEMET) offers 250V with improved ±5% tolerance. Both maintain X7R temperature coefficient and 0805 package.
Temperature Coefficient Alternative (250V, C0G/NP0): C0805C332JAGAC7800 (KEMET) provides 250V rating with C0G/NP0 temperature coefficient and ±5% tolerance. C0G/NP0 offers superior capacitance stability across temperature compared to X7R, suitable for precision applications.
High Voltage Options (500V–630V, X7R): C0805C332KCRAC7800 and C0805V332KCRAC7800 (KEMET) provide 500V rating. C0805C332KBRAC7800 (KEMET) provides 630V rating. All maintain ±10% tolerance and X7R coefficient. These options accommodate higher voltage stress environments while preserving the 0805 form factor.
All substitute and upgrade options are ROHS3 compliant and carry MSL 1 (Unlimited) moisture sensitivity rating, matching the original part's environmental specifications.
Frequently Asked Questions (FAQ)
Q: Can C0805C332K2RAC7800 directly replace ECJ-2VB2D332K? A: Yes. C0805C332K2RAC7800 matches all critical parameters: 3300 pF capacitance, ±10% tolerance, 200V rating, X7R temperature coefficient, and 0805 package. It is an active product with ROHS3 compliance.
Q: What is the difference between X7R and C0G/NP0 temperature coefficients? A: X7R maintains capacitance within ±15% across -55°C to 125°C operating range. C0G/NP0 maintains capacitance within ±30 ppm/°C, providing superior stability for precision applications. C0G/NP0 is suitable when tighter capacitance tolerance across temperature is required.
Q: Can I use a 250V or 500V rated capacitor in place of the 200V original? A: Yes. Higher voltage ratings are acceptable substitutes. A 250V, 500V, or 630V rated capacitor will function in a 200V application. However, physical dimensions may differ; verify thickness and footprint compatibility with your PCB layout before substitution.
Q: What is the significance of the thickness difference between KEMET and YAGEO/KYOCERA AVX options? A: KEMET C0805C332K2RAC7800 has 0.88mm maximum thickness, while YAGEO CC0805KRX7RABB332 and KYOCERA AVX KGM21AR72D332KU have 1.45mm maximum thickness. Verify PCB clearance and component stacking height requirements before selecting. Thinner options are preferred for space-constrained designs.
Q: Are all substitute parts ROHS3 compliant? A: Yes. All active substitute and upgrade options listed are ROHS3 compliant. The original ECJ-2VB2D332K (obsolete) does not specify RoHS status.
Q: What does MSL 1 (Unlimited) mean? A: MSL 1 indicates the component has unlimited shelf life and requires no special moisture control during storage or handling. All listed parts carry this rating.
